Primary clocked DC converter modules are used, among other things, to generate different (consumer) voltage levels from central DC voltages, also battery-supported.
Our clocked DC converter modules for use in the low-voltage range can be connected in parallel in any quantity to increase power and redundancy.
The units are designed as plug-in modules for cabinet installation and offer galvanic isolation between input and output.
The connections on the front make it easy to replace the modules. On request, we offer special DC converters without galvanic isolation for adapting specific battery voltage ranges to specified consumer voltages, for example (function: e.g. “step-up converter”).

Essential features
Galvanic isolation between input and output
High efficiencies
Parallel switchable without additional control unit
Fanless design (low noise, no fan replacement necessary)
High test voltages acc. EN 50124-1 from the railroad sector
Module-specific:
Integrated decoupling diode
2 x IN Short-circuit current, limited to 1.2 to 1.5 s
Relay interface with potential-free changeover contact (operation / fault)
Signalling by means of LEDs, partly digital voltmeter
